Write four solutions for each of the following equations
$4 x-3 y=24$

Solution
$4 x-3 y=24$
$\therefore 4 x-24=3 y$
$\therefore y=\frac{4 x-24}{3}$
Taking $x=0,$ we get $y=\frac{4(0)-24}{3}=\frac{-24}{3}=-8$
So, $(0,-8)$ is a solution of the given equation.
Taking $x=3,$ we get
$y=\frac{4(3)-24}{3}=\frac{-12}{3}=-4$
So, $(3,-4)$ is a solution of the given
equation. Taking $x=6,$ we get $y=\frac{4(6)-24}{3}=\frac{0}{3}=0$
So, $(6,0)$ is a solution of the given equation. Taking $x=9,$ we get $y=\frac{4(9)-24}{3}=\frac{12}{3}=4$
So, $(9,4)$ is a solution of the given equation.
So, four of the infinitely many solutions
of the given equation are
$(0,-8),(3,-4),(6,0)$ and $(9,4)$
